Output 660afa1c1db61a92d4d355d21722ce97d509062e9630eae64c5b317bf08f8625:1

value
15618494
script pubkey
OP_0 OP_PUSHBYTES_20 a56cdc0a89e385daae4a10d3e8958cd51eb20361
address
ltc1q54kdcz5fuwza4tj2zrf739vv650tyqmpdga3mw
transaction
660afa1c1db61a92d4d355d21722ce97d509062e9630eae64c5b317bf08f8625
spent
true